Ingredients You’ll Need

Each ingredient in this Meat Lovers Pizza Tacos Recipe plays a crucial role in creating a balance of savory, cheesy, and slightly tangy notes. These simple components come together effortlessly but don’t underestimate their power to make every bite vibrant and satisfying.

  • Ground beef (1 lb): Provides a flavorful, meaty base that’s rich and hearty.
  • Italian sausage, crumbled (1/2 lb): Adds a spicy, aromatic punch that elevates the dish.
  • Pepperoni slices (1/2 lb): Brings that classic pizza zing with perfectly seasoned meat.
  • Sliced black olives (1/2 cup): Offers a salty, briny contrast that balances the richness.
  • Shredded mozzarella cheese (1 cup): Melts beautifully for that gooey, stretchy goodness.
  • Shredded cheddar cheese (1 cup): Adds sharpness and depth of flavor to the cheesy topping.
  • Pizza sauce (1 cup): Provides the tangy tomato base that ties all ingredients together.
  • Small flour tortillas (8): Serve as the perfect soft but sturdy shell substituting for pizza crust.
  • Dried oregano (1 teaspoon): Infuses a classic Italian herb aroma that complements the meats.
  • Garlic powder (1 teaspoon): Adds a subtle savory layer without overpowering the other flavors.
  • Salt and pepper, to taste: Essential seasoning to enhance every ingredient’s natural taste.

How to Make Meat Lovers Pizza Tacos Recipe

Step 1: Cook the Meats

Start by heating a large skillet over medium heat and cooking the ground beef alongside the crumbled Italian sausage until fully browned. This step is key as browning the meat develops deep flavors and a satisfying texture. After draining any excess fat, season the mixture with dried oregano,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Stir everything together to marry those Italian-inspired herbs with the savory meat blend, then set it aside for the next step.

Step 2: Prepare the Tortillas

Preheat your oven to a cozy 375°F (190°C), the perfect temperature to melt the cheese without drying out the tortillas. Take each small flour tortilla and spread a thin, even layer of pizza sauce over the surface. This saucy base gives moisture, tang, and a burst of classic pizza flavor to hold all the toppings in place.

Step 3: Assemble the Pizza Tacos

Now comes the fun part: layering. Evenly distribute the cooked meat mixture over the sauced tortillas. Next, layer on pepperoni slices and black olives, providing both spice and a salty pop. Finally, sprinkle generously with shredded mozzarella and cheddar cheeses. These cheeses will melt into a gooey blanket that unifies all the ingredients.

Step 4: Bake to Perfection

Place your assembled tortillas on a baking sheet and pop them into the preheated oven. Bake for 10 to 12 minutes until the cheese is melted and bubbly and the edges of the tortillas begin to crisp up slightly. This finishing bake is what transforms these simple ingredients into an irresistible pizza taco combination.

Step 5: Cool and Garnish

Once out of the oven, allow your pizza tacos to cool just a little to avoid burning eager fingers. Sprinkle chopped fresh basil, grated Parmesan, and a pinch of red pepper flakes if you like a bit of heat. Cutting each taco into wedges makes them perfect for sharing and snacking, bringing everyone around the table to enjoy these saucy, meaty creations.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Leftover Meat Lovers Pizza Tacos Recipe keeps well when st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. To keep the tortillas from getting soggy, place parchment paper between layers if stacking. This way, you’ll have easy, delicious meals ready for reheating.

Freezing

You can freeze these pizza tacos for longer storage by wrapping each individually in foil or plastic wrap and placing them in a freezer-safe bag. Frozen properly, they maintain good flavor and texture for up to two months, making meal prep a breeze for busy days.

Reheating

To reheat, place the pizza tacos on a baking sheet and warm them in a 350°F (175°C) oven for about 10 minutes until the cheese bubbles again and the tortilla crisps up nicely. Avoid microwaving for best texture, as it can make the tortillas chewy instead of delightfully crispy.

FAQs

Can I use corn tortillas instead of flour tortillas?

Absolutely! Corn tortillas will give these pizza tacos a slightly different texture and a subtle corn flavor that pairs nicely with the savory ingredients. Just be sure to warm them gently before assembling to prevent cracking.

Is it possible to make a vegetarian version?

Yes! Swap the meats for plant-based sausage and pepperoni alternatives, and add hearty veggies like mushrooms and bell peppers. Use the same cheese and sauce to keep the pizza taco spirit alive.

How spicy is this Meat Lovers Pizza Tacos Recipe?

The spice level is mild by default, focusing on savory and cheesy flavors. You can increase heat by adding crushed red pepper flakes, hot sauce, or spicy sausage to suit your taste buds perfectly.

Can I prepare this recipe in advance for a party?

Definitely. You can cook the meats and assemble the tacos a few hours before baking, then keep them covered in the fridge. When guests arrive, just pop them in the oven to bake fresh and bubbly.

What are some good dips to serve with these pizza tacos?

Marinara sauce, garlic ranch dip, or even a spicy chipotle mayo work wonderfully as dips that complement the pizza taco flavors and add an extra layer of deliciousness.

Meat Lovers Pizza Tacos Recipe

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star 4.2 from 40 reviews
  • Author: Mary
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 8 servings
  • Category: Main Course
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American

Description

These Meat Lovers Pizza Tacos combine the hearty flavors of ground beef, Italian sausage, and pepperoni with classic pizza toppings on crispy flour tortillas. Baked to perfection with melted mozzarella and cheddar cheese, they offer a fun and satisfying twist on traditional pizza that’s perfect for a casual meal or party snack.


Ingredients

Scale

Meat Mixture

  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1/2 lb Italian sausage, crumbled
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Pizza Toppings

  • 1/2 lb pepperoni slices
  • 1/2 cup sliced black olives
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up pizza sauce

Base

  • 8 small flour tortillas

Optional Garnishes

  • Chopped fresh basil
  • Grated Parmesan cheese
  • Red pepper flakes


Instructions

  1. Cook the Meat: In a large skillet over medium heat, cook the ground beef and Italian sausage until fully browned, breaking it up as it cooks. Drain any excess fat, then add dried oregano,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Stir well to combine and then set the meat mixture aside.
  2. Prepare the Tortillas: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Lay out the flour tortillas and spread a thin, even layer of pizza sauce on each one.
  3. Assemble the Pizza Tacos: Evenly distribute the cooked meat mixture over the sauced tortillas. Top each with pepperoni slices, black olives, shredded mozzarella, and cheddar cheese, ensuring good coverage for a deliciously cheesy finish.
  4. Bake: Place the prepared tortillas on a baking sheet and bake in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es. Bake until the cheese has melted fully, is bubbly, and the edges of the tortillas have turned crispy.
  5. Serve: Remove the pizza tacos from the oven and let them cool for a few minutes. Optionally garnish with chopped fresh basil, grated Parmesan, and red pepper flakes. Cut each taco into wedges and serve warm for a tasty and fun meal.

Notes

  • You can substitute turkey sausage to make a leaner version of this recipe.
  • Feel free to add your favorite pizza vegetables like mushrooms or bell peppers for extra flavor and nutrition.
  • Use corn tortillas for a gluten-free alternative, but they may be less sturdy when loaded.
  •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heated in the oven for best texture.
  • If you prefer spicier tacos, add red pepper flakes into the meat mixture when cooking.
